Anyway here is a movie that is worth watching:



One of the first war movies to not be a meaningless piece of propaganda. It's set in France during World War II. An offensive is planned against a German trench. The offensive is poorly coordinated and results in thousands of casualties. Three of the soldiers from the division are tried for cowardice as a means for the high command to cover up their reckless disregard for their own men's lives.

the last few films i've seen:

let the right one in.



This is a slightly disturbing and good vampire flick that isn't cheesy and is well developed.

Invictus



This was a good film about post apartheid south africa, and the most important thing for me was how it showed how mandela didn't seek cheap revenge over the afrikaans.

' he spent 30 years in this tiny cell, ready to help the people that put him here'

Hurt locker


an abstract apolitical reflection on bomb disposal in iraq and the adrenaline rush.

it reflects on the cynicism of troops and differing motives and experiences soldiers have, many of the characters being composite characters based on actual people the journalist author encountered whilst being a journalist embedded within U.S units.
